What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R  1926.102(a)(1): The employer did not ensure that each affected employee uses appropriate eye or face protection when exposed to eye or face hazards from flying particles, molten metal, liquid chemicals, acids or caustic liquids, chemical gases or vapors, or potentially injurious light radiation:  On or about December 10, 2020, employees were using pneumatic nail guns to install the LATH for the stucco on the residential apartments under construction without eye protection, exposing employees to the hazard of being struck by flying objects.

29 CFR  1926.451(b)(1): Each platform on all working levels of scaffolds was not fully planked or decked between the front uprights and the guardrail supports:  On or about December 10, 2020, employees were installing LATH and applying stucco for the residential apartments under construction from the 2nd tier of a tubular welded scaffold approximately 14 feet high with the working level not fully planked between the uprights, exposing employees to a fall hazard.

29 CFR  1926.451(h)(2)(ii): A toeboard was not erected along the edge of platforms more than 10 feet (3.1 m) above lower levels for a distance sufficient to protect employees below:    On or about December 10, 2020, employees were installing LATH and applying stucco to the residential apartments under construction working from the second tier of a tubular welded scaffold up to approximately 14 feet high without toeboards, exposing the workers to the hazard of being struck-by tools and materials.
